NSB Omega is searching for an Electrical Design Engineer for our MAJOR Utilities Client in St. John's, NL. Assignment Description Key Responsibilities This position will be an embedded position, for and Electrical Design Engineer with P.Eng designation and currently in good standing with PEGNL, working with the Electrical Engineering team group as a design engineer. The main responsibility is to support the Capital Program delivery and working inside a project team providing Electrical Design Engineering support. This will include designing, estimating, drawing development, specification development, Tender and Contract preparation, Contract management, Commissioning and Energization Plan development, on site support, and project close out. They will also support the Electrical Engineering department as required with Technical Service Requests and Standards development. Education & Experience Required Successful candidate must possess a Bachelor of Engineering - Electrical and hold a P.Eng designation within the Province of Newfoundland and be in good standing with PEGNL.
